The inside diameter of a cylindrical tube is a random variable with a mean of 3 inches and a standard deviation of 0.02 inch, the thickness of the tube is a random variable with a mean of 0.3 inch and a standard deviation of 0.005 inch, and the two random variables are independent. Find the mean and the standard deviation of the outside diameter of the tube.
